U-M and MSU buck nationwide trend of athletics cuts

MSU enforced a 10 percent across-the-board cut in spending for this year, but hopes to preserve the sports experience for athletes.

Among the enduring values of the state of Michigan is that athletic participation and accomplishment on campus are eminently worthwhile pursuits. The long-standing, national leadership of sports programs at the University of Michigan and Michigan State University, especially, are largely taken for granted and are sources of pride. But, nationally, the financial health of athletics increasingly is at risk. - 11/06/2009
